Gills have made 2 late Deadline day signings with an hour of the window remaining! Joe Quigley returns to the club after having his initial loan spell abruptly cut short through injury and close to returning from injury in the next few weeks.

The second player is winger Harry Cornick. Both join on loan from Bournemouth and are the third from the club to have been loaned to the Gills this season.

No defender what most fans wanted however.
